USPS Carrier Delivers Mail for Final Time After 31 Years — and Is Shocked by Community’s Surprise Gesture

Every day for 24 years, Bill Buda walked the same route between Silver Lake Village and Stow, Ohio.

A USPS mail carrier for 31 years, Bill, 59, exemplified dedication, putting his heart and soul into his career. He built lasting relationships with the families he served, often watching their children grow up, and only took a sick day twice.

At one point in his career, he wore a different sports team’s hat every day. It became a game for the kids and older residents he served to guess which hat he was wearing. He’d cover the logo, and based on the colors, they would try to guess, or he’d give hints about whether it was MLB or NFL, for example.
